DeltaV Spectral PAT runs chemometric models directly in the control system, allowing real-time prediction of critical quality attributes. This means that you can now monitor and perform closed-loop control with these hard-to-measure critical values. Traditional implementation of PAT using spectroscopy can be challenging to implement and maintain, mainly when critical quality measurements are used in closed-loop control strategies. Using spectral analyzers from on-line product samples, DeltaV Spectral PAT’s modern machine learning algorithms and embedded chemometric models can accurately predict product quality for use as on-line quality soft sensors.

DeltaV Spectral PAT enables real-time quality monitoring in pharmaceutical manufacturing by using in-line spectroscopy and embedded chemometric models to predict critical quality attributes. This approach eliminates delayed lab testing and supports continuous process verification within a distributed control system (DCS).

DeltaV Spectral PAT differs from traditional PAT systems by embedding analytics directly into the control system instead of using complex, multi-layer architectures. This simplifies integration, improves reliability, and enables real-time closed-loop control in industrial processes.
